Milo Edmund Karasek 1925 - 2011

Milo Edmund Karasek of Omaha, Douglas County, Nebraska was born on November 16, 1925 to Lillian (Suchy) Karasek. He had siblings Robert Millard Karasek, Charles Karasek, Patricia Karasek, and Lillian Karasek. Milo Karasek died at age 85 years old on June 15, 2011.

Did you know?
In 1925, in the year that Milo Edmund Karasek was born, gangster Al "Scarface" Capone took over the Chicago bootlegging racket at age 26. Previously right hand man to boss Johnny Torrio, Capone took over when Torrio was shot and severely injured and decided to resign. The bootlegging and brothel organization was massive and when asked what he did, Capone often replied "I am just a businessman, giving the people what they want".
Did you know?
In 1935, by the time he was merely 10 years old, the BOI's name (the Bureau of Investigation) was changed to the FBI (Federal Bureau of Investigation) and it officially became a separate agency with the Department of Justice. J. Edgar Hoover, the Chief of the BOI, continued in his office and became the first Director of the FBI. The FBI's responsibility is to "detect and prosecute crimes against the United States".
